
Presidential Facts about James Knox Polk
James Knox Polk - 11th President of the United States serving 1 term, from 1845 to 1849.
Vice President - George Mifflin Dallas
Born - November 2, 1795
Died - June 15, 1849
First Lady - Sarah Childress Polk
Party - Democratic
James Knox Polk is from North Carolina.
